Hey Community,
ich bin gerade mit meiner Abschulssprogrammierarbeit für meinen Schulgang
"Berufskolleg für Informations- und Kommunikationstechnik" beschäftigt und habe seit 3 Tagen ein Problem welches ich nicht bewältigt bekomme!
Nach endloser Suche im Internet und zahlreichen Toutorials die komplett an der Problemstelle aufhören
hab ich mich entschieden nach etwas professionelleren Rat zu fragen!
Ich Programmiere eine Gui die zu einem Algorithmus und einer Sende+Empfangsfunktion (wobei dieser Teil irrelevant ist) funktionieren muss!
In der Gui soll an einer Stelle die Zeit in Millisekunden hochzählen! Das ist ja an sich kein Problem!
Jetzt kann ich nur natürlich nicht durchgehen den Zähler hochlaufen lassen, da die Gui durchgehend Befehle empfangen und verarbeiten wird!
Ich hatte zuerst an Threads gedacht, jedoch baut sich die Gui bereits auf die JFrame-Klasse auf weshalb ein extends Thread nicht möglich ist
Ein weiteres Problem ist folgendes: Wenn die Gui läuft kann ich nicht mit einer anderen Klasse darauf zugreifen! (Könnte möglicherweise auch an Netbeans liegen, da beide Klassen im gleichen netbeans aufgerufen werden!)
Der Zähler ist hierbei wohl nur die 1er-Bremse was die Abgabe angeht!
Was wirklich wichtig ist ist die Möglichkeit die Gui über eine andere Klasse zu steuern wobei ich keine Ahnung hab wie ich das erreiche!
In der Schule hab ich eig. immer nur mit einer Main-Methode zu tun gehabt die alle Klassen gesteuert hat!
Hier sind es jetzt mehrere
Funktioniert das so überhaupt?
Könnt ihr mir einen schnellen Tipp geben wie ich die Gui von anderen Klassen aus ansprechbar machen kann? Über Problemlösungen zum Zählerproblem würd ich natürlich auch nicht nörgeln :applaus: is nur nicht ganz so dringend
LG lLycan
ich bin gerade mit meiner Abschulssprogrammierarbeit für meinen Schulgang
"Berufskolleg für Informations- und Kommunikationstechnik" beschäftigt und habe seit 3 Tagen ein Problem welches ich nicht bewältigt bekomme!
Nach endloser Suche im Internet und zahlreichen Toutorials die komplett an der Problemstelle aufhören
hab ich mich entschieden nach etwas professionelleren Rat zu fragen!
Ich Programmiere eine Gui die zu einem Algorithmus und einer Sende+Empfangsfunktion (wobei dieser Teil irrelevant ist) funktionieren muss!
In der Gui soll an einer Stelle die Zeit in Millisekunden hochzählen! Das ist ja an sich kein Problem!
Jetzt kann ich nur natürlich nicht durchgehen den Zähler hochlaufen lassen, da die Gui durchgehend Befehle empfangen und verarbeiten wird!
Ich hatte zuerst an Threads gedacht, jedoch baut sich die Gui bereits auf die JFrame-Klasse auf weshalb ein extends Thread nicht möglich ist
Ein weiteres Problem ist folgendes: Wenn die Gui läuft kann ich nicht mit einer anderen Klasse darauf zugreifen! (Könnte möglicherweise auch an Netbeans liegen, da beide Klassen im gleichen netbeans aufgerufen werden!)
Der Zähler ist hierbei wohl nur die 1er-Bremse was die Abgabe angeht!
Was wirklich wichtig ist ist die Möglichkeit die Gui über eine andere Klasse zu steuern wobei ich keine Ahnung hab wie ich das erreiche!
In der Schule hab ich eig. immer nur mit einer Main-Methode zu tun gehabt die alle Klassen gesteuert hat!
Hier sind es jetzt mehrere
Funktioniert das so überhaupt?
Könnt ihr mir einen schnellen Tipp geben wie ich die Gui von anderen Klassen aus ansprechbar machen kann? Über Problemlösungen zum Zählerproblem würd ich natürlich auch nicht nörgeln :applaus: is nur nicht ganz so dringend
LG lLycan